1. Range Kind

Range kind considerably influences weight. Categorization by gas kind and configuration gives a framework for understanding weight variations.

  • Electrical Stoves

    Electrical stoves, together with smooth-top and coil fashions, typically weigh lower than gasoline ranges. An ordinary electrical vary usually weighs between 100 and 200 kilos. Smaller apartment-sized fashions can weigh as little as 50 kilos, whereas bigger, slide-in ranges can attain 250 kilos. Weight variations stem from variations in measurement, options, and the supplies used of their development.

  • Fuel Stoves

    Fuel stoves are usually heavier than electrical counterparts resulting from inside elements like gasoline strains, valves, and burners. An ordinary gasoline vary usually weighs between 150 and 300 kilos. Bigger, professional-style gasoline ranges can exceed 400 kilos. The added weight requires strong set up help and cautious dealing with throughout transport.

  • Induction Cooktops

    Induction cooktops are typically lighter than conventional electrical and gasoline ranges. They usually weigh between 30 and 50 kilos resulting from their compact design and lack of heavy inside elements like ovens. This lighter weight facilitates simpler set up and portability.

  • Downdraft Ranges

    Downdraft ranges incorporate a built-in air flow system, including to their general weight. These ranges usually weigh between 200 and 350 kilos, with variations relying on measurement and options. The added weight of the air flow system necessitates cautious consideration throughout set up.

Understanding these weight ranges by range kind facilitates knowledgeable choices relating to transportation, set up, and ground help necessities. Consulting producer specs gives essentially the most correct weight info for a particular mannequin.
